Cyber-related crimes have reportedly been on the rise during the lockdown. In an interview, Women Safety Wing DIG Sumathi (IPS) has talked about how some female targets are trapped by cyber criminals.

During the lockdown, old crimes have been committed in a new way. During normal times, the morphing of photos, etc. used to be commonplace. Of late, fraudsters are not assuming fake identities. They are approaching their prey with their real identity. They first learn about their potential prey's information by searching for online information (on social media, etc.). They then decide how to enter into a relationship with you, she begins saying.

Recently, a middle-aged woman working in an MNC in Hyderabad got cheated because a fraudster learned that she has been looking for ways to shed down her weight. Her online history was clear about her desperation. He tried to capitalize on it by sending a simple WhatsApp message, saying that he is from the UK and that he is an expert at fitness. For a month, he sent her tips on weight reduction and what she can do. He won her confidence by chatting only about weight reduction, she adds.

Finally, she started becoming closer and started sharing things about the differences between her and her husband. Eventually, he prepared a collage of photos of her in inappropriate poses, etc. He blackmailed her and demanded Rs 1 lakh. Her husband wouldn't believe her because she had shared intimate pics and videos with the fraudster, the IPS officer says.

Since she works for an MNC, she could muster up the courage to come to the cybercrime department and ask us to help her. The victim's husband needed to be counseled about the ways of cybercriminals to impress upon him the fact that his wife has been trapped, Sumathi adds.
